Frances Bean Cobain is now a mom.

The sole offspring of the late rock legend Kurt Cobain and musician Courtney Love has given birth to her initial child with spouse Riley Hawk, who is the oldest son of renowned skateboarder Tony Hawk.

9th of July, 2024, Ronin Walker Cobain Hawk, as Frances, aged 32, expressed on Instagram on the 28th of September, accompanied by images of her and Riley’s newborn baby boy, and a proud father cradling the infant. “Welcome to the world, our most beautiful son! We love you infinitely.

Tony, now a first-time grandfather, commented, “My favorite grandson!” He also shared an identical birth announcement that Riley—whose mom is the athlete’s ex-wife Cindy Dunbar— had posted on his own Instagram page.

Frances was just 19 months old when her dad, who was only 27, passed away in the year 1994. Recently, on the 30th anniversary of his passing, which occurred in April, she paid tribute to Kurt by posting some childhood photos featuring herself and him.

She posted on Instagram that the second and third pictures were from our last meeting before he passed away,” she wrote. “His mom Wendy would frequently place my hands against her cheeks and whisper, ‘You have his hands,’ with a heavy sadness. She seemed to inhale them deeply, as if it was her last opportunity to hold him closer, even if just for a moment frozen in time. I hope she’s holding his hands wherever they may be now.
